AMERICAN FLIGHT 11

-

Flight plan: Boston to Los Angeles. Crashes into north tower of World Trade Center. 8:00:00 Plane takes off. 8:13 Boston Control Center: “AAL11 turn 20 degrees right.” AAL11: “20 right AAL11.” Controller: “AAL11 now climb, maintain FL350 (35,000 feet).” Controller: “AAL11 climb, maintain FL350.” Controller: “AAL11 Boston.” 8:14:33 Controller A: “AAL11 ah the American on the frequency, how do you hear me?” Controller B: “This is uh Athens.” A: “This is Boston. I turned American 20 left and I was going to climb him he will not respond to me now at all.” B: “Looks like he’s turning right.“A: “Yea, I turned him right.” B:“Oh, OK” A: “And he’s only going to um I think 29.” B: “Sure, that’s fine.” A: “Eh, but I’m not talking to him.” B: “He won’t answer you. He’s nordo (no radio) roger. Thanks.” 8:24:38 Hijackers’ voices heard: “We have some planes. Just stay quiet and you will be OK. We are returning to the airport. Nobody move, everything will be OK. If you try to make any moves, you’ll endanger yourself and the airplane. Just stay quiet.” 8:25:00 The control tower notifies several air traffic control centers that a hijacking is in progress. 8:33:59 Hijackers’ voices heard: “Nobody move please, we are going back to the airport. Don’t try to make any stupid moves.” 8:47:00 Plane crashes into the north tower of the World Trade Center. Hijackers: Mohamed Atta (Egyptian), Abdulaziz al-Omari (Saudi Arabian), Wail al-Shehri (Saudi Arabian), Waleed al-Shehri (Saudi Arabian), Satam al-Suqami (Saudi Arabian)
